Bernie Sanders wins Wyoming caucus


Democratic presidential hopeful Bernie Sanders won the Wyoming caucus Saturday, The Associated Press reports, marking his eighth win over Hillary Clinton in the last nine state contests. With about 96 percent of the results reported, Sanders led Clinton with 56 percent support to 44 percent.
Wyoming is a low-stakes state with just 14 delegates, and Clinton still holds a massive lead in delegates and superdelegates overall.
